Question: For a JDK upgrade change request to a production server, how should I provide test evidence for the change request?

Answer:

For a production JDK upgrade, the goal is to prove that:

  1. The application works correctly with the new JDK.
  2. No critical functionality is broken.
  3. Performance is acceptable.
  4. The rollback plan is ready if issues occur.

A typical change request (CR) test evidence package includes the following.

1. Environment Information

Document the current and target versions.

Item Current Target
OS RHEL 8 RHEL 8
JDK JDK 11.0.20 JDK 17.0.12
Application MyApp 3.2.1 MyApp 3.2.1
Server App Server A App Server A

Example evidence:

java -version

openjdk version "17.0.12" 2025-07-15
OpenJDK Runtime Environment
OpenJDK 64-Bit Server VM

Include screenshots or console output.


2. Build Verification

Show that the application builds successfully using the new JDK.

Example:

mvn clean package
BUILD SUCCESS

or

gradle build
BUILD SUCCESSFUL

3. Application Startup Verification

Demonstrate that the application starts successfully.

Evidence:

systemctl status myapp

Active: active (running)

Application log:

Application started successfully
Started MyApp in 23.4 seconds

4. Smoke Testing (Most Important)

Execute key business functions.

Example:

Test Case Result
User Login Pass
Account Search Pass
Payment Processing Pass
Report Generation Pass
Batch Job Execution Pass

5. Regression Test Results

If your organization has automated tests:

Total Tests: 523
Passed: 523
Failed: 0

6. Performance Comparison

Compare old and new JDK.

Example:

Metric Before After
Startup Time 35 sec 28 sec
Heap Usage 4.2 GB 4.0 GB
Avg Response Time 210 ms 205 ms

9. Rollback Test

Provide rollback procedure.

Example:

1. Stop application
2. Switch JAVA_HOME back to JDK 11
3. Restart application
4. Verify health endpoint

Evidence:

Rollback tested successfully in UAT.
Estimated duration: 10 minutes.

10. Sample Change Request Test Evidence Summary

A concise summary often accepted by CAB/Change Management:

JDK Upgrade Test Evidence

Change: Upgrade JDK from 11.0.20 to 17.0.12 on Production Application Servers.

Testing Performed:

  1. Application compiled successfully using JDK 17.
  2. Application startup completed successfully with no errors.
  3. Smoke testing executed:

    • User Login: PASS
    • Account Search: PASS
    • Payment Processing: PASS
    • Report Generation: PASS
  4. Regression test suite executed:

    • Total Tests: 523
    • Passed: 523
    • Failed: 0
  5. Health checks verified:

    • Database connectivity: PASS
    • MQ connectivity: PASS
    • External API connectivity: PASS
  6. Performance comparison showed no degradation.
  7. Rollback procedure validated in UAT.

Conclusion: The application is fully compatible with JDK 17. No functional or performance issues were identified. Production implementation is recommended.
